2023 gichi manidoo giizis pow wow traditional, January 13-14, Black Bear Casino and Hotel-Otter Creek Event Center, Carlton. The Thirteen Moons Fond du Lac tribal college outreach program hosts the pow wow to celebrate caring for the land and community. The mission of the 2023 Gichi Manidoo Giizis Traditional Pow Wow is to bring together federal, tribal and state community members and organizations to learn from each other about how we care for the land and community. Organization representatives will be available to answer questions and provide information on sustainable agriculture, natural resource programs for landowners, and educational and career opportunities through college and university programs. In addition, these representatives will learn from community members the traditions of the Anishinaabe culture, language, and best practices for caring for the land and the community.
